Yezashimi in context

With 713 people at the 2011 Census, Yezashimi was the 46th most populous of its district's 191 villages, above the district average of 592.

Literacy stood at 64.52%, 18.4 points below the district's rural average of 82.96%.

The sex ratio was 1085 women per 1,000 men (92 above the district's rural figure of 993) — one of the minority of villages where women outnumbered men.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 676, 247 below the rural national 923.

52.6% of the population were recorded as workers, 9.4 points below the district's rural rate.
